  • Patent number: 7312931
    Abstract: The present invention provides a zoom lens provided with, in order from an object side: a first lens group having a positive refractive power whose position on the optical axis is fixed during a zooming operation and a focusing operation; a second lens group having a negative refractive power; a third lens group having a positive refractive power; a fourth lens group having a positive refractive power; a fifth lens group having a negative refractive power; and a sixth lens group having a positive refractive power. The first lens group includes a reflection optical element. At least the fifth lens group is used for focusing on an object at a finite distance. The maximum lateral magnification of the predetermined lens groups between a wide-angle end and a telephoto end of the zoom lens and focal lengths of the zoom lens satisfy a predetermined condition.

  • Patent number: 7253962
    Abstract: A zoom lens including a first lens unit exhibiting a positive refractive power and always being statically positioned along an optical axis when a power of the zoom lens is varied or the focusing is conducted and including a reflective optical element for bending an optical path, a second lens unit exhibiting a negative refractive power and including a negative lens, a negative lens and a positive lens, along the optical axis in this order from an object side, a third lens unit exhibiting a positive refractive power, a fourth lens unit exhibiting a positive refractive power, and including at least two positive lenses, and a fifth lens unit exhibiting a negative refractive power, wherein the second lens unit, the fourth lens unit and the fifth lens unit are moved for varying the power of the zoom lens.

  • Patent number: 7218461
    Abstract: An image pickup lens for forming image of a subject on a solid-state image pickup element includes: a first lens having a positive refractive power in a meniscus shape whose convex surface faces to an object side of the image pickup lens; an aperture stop; a second lens having a positive refractive power in a meniscus shape whose convex surface faces to an image side of the image pickup lens; a third lens having a negative refractive power whose concave surface faces to an object side of the image pickup lens. The first lens, the aperture stop, the second lens and the third lens are arranged in this order form an object side of the image pickup lens. The first lens and the third lens satisfy a predefined conditional expression.

  • Publication number: 20060092310
    Abstract: A picture-taking lens for forming an image of an object image on a solid picture-taking element, comprising in order from the object side: a first lens having a positive refractive power and directing a convex surface toward the object side; an aperture stop, a second lens having a positive refractive power and a meniscus shape directing a convex surface toward the image side; and a third lens having a negative refractive power and directing a concave surface toward the image side, wherein the picture-taking lens satisfies the following conditional expression: 0.20<R1/f<0.42, 0.10<D2/f<0.40, where R1 is a radius of curvature of the object side surface of the first lens, D2 is an air gap on the axis between the first lens and the second lens, f is a focal length of a whole system of the picture-taking lens.
